Kristen M. Danyluk / Associate
Professional Experience
Kristen Danyluk practices in the Corporate Services Group. She specializes in mergers and acquisitions, representing both buyers and sellers in stock and asset transactions. Kristen also represents institutional investors in their investment activities, including their potential investments in private equity funds, hedge funds, venture capital funds, and other alternative investment vehicles. In addition, she regularly advises privately held companies on business planning and formation and general corporate matters. Her recent experience includes:
  • Advising public charity and foundation investors on private equity and hedge fund investments and negotiating terms and side letters where appropriate.

  • Representing a private equity firm in the acquisition and disposition of its portfolio companies.

  • Representing a public company in the divestiture of one of its business divisions.

  • Advising clients regarding general business planning and forming business entities, including limited partnerships and limited liability companies.
